
Electrical Poltergeist
I was told this one by a friend who said this happened to a relative of his.
Nancy was working on a jigsaw puzzle at home alone one night. The TV was turned to a talk show. She wasn't really paying attention to the TV, but she felt comfortable with it on. Engrossed in the puzzle she didn't notice that the audio of the television had become garbled. Slowly she started to notice that the voices were distorted, and they didn't match up with the speaker's mouths. She picked up the remote and flipped through the channels, the picture changed, but not the sound. She turned off the TV and the sound slowly faded away. The silence made her almost as scared as the noise did. She turned on the radio only to hear that same noise! It was the talk show on TV, except it sounded like it was being stretched out! She turned it off and picked up the phone to call a friend to pick her up, but instead of a dial tone she heard a screeching! From the kitchen she heard the blender, dish washer, and the garbage disposal turn on! From the garage came the sound of various power tools! The radio and TV suddenly came on! Then it stopped. The rest of her family returned minutes later to find her curled up in a corner of her room crying. After some time of trying to get her to stop her parents finally got the story out of her. The couldn't make heads or tails of it. 'You must have had a dream or something,' her father said. 'I wasn't asleep the whole night!' Nancy said. The conversation came up with many ideas, but no one suggested it was a ghost. The had a electrition come and check out the wiring, but he didn't find anything wrong. Near the end of his check everything turned on like before! He unplugged a few things and they turned off slowly. Everything stoped a few minutes later. 'I don't know what to tell you,' the electrician said. 'I've never seen anything like this before.' This happened many times over the next few months scaring the family into considering moving. But before they could call anyone about selling, the TV alone turned on to a station playing the Star Spangled Banner as it was going off-line for the night. Then it went to static. The family decided to wait for the occurance to happen again before calling a realestate agent about selling the house. It never happened again.
